Dr. Pedi Mirdamadi, a licensed naturopathic doctor, recently shared a technique on social media that's gaining traction. He explains that while some snore due to anatomical differences or weight, others snore because their tongue muscles lack tone. And this is the part most people miss: a simple 'clicking' exercise can strengthen those muscles, potentially leading to a significant reduction in snoring. This isn't just anecdotal advice; it's backed by science. Studies published in reputable journals like CHEST and Sleep & Breathing show that targeted tongue and throat exercises can decrease snoring frequency by up to 36% and improve overall sleep quality. So, how does it work? Dr. Mirdamadi's method is refreshingly straightforward. Here's the breakdown: * Sit or stand tall. * Press your tongue firmly against the roof of your mouth. * Snap it back, creating a 'click' sound. * Repeat this 15-30 times daily. This simple routine aims to strengthen the tongue and throat muscles, preventing them from collapsing and blocking your airway during sleep. But is it enough? While this exercise shows promise, it's not a magic bullet. For lasting results, combine it with lifestyle changes like maintaining a healthy weight, sleeping on your side, avoiding pre-bed alcohol, and keeping nasal passages clear. These habits work together to optimize airflow and minimize snoring. Controversially, some argue that focusing solely on exercises might overlook underlying conditions like sleep apnea. If you experience pauses in breathing, excessive daytime fatigue, or loud gasping during sleep, consulting a sleep specialist is crucial.
